The Factors Behind The Quote
When a quote feels high, it is usually because one or more of these elements are pushing the labor or material cost up.
- Window size and shape. A standard double-hung unit is typically cheaper than a picture window, bay window, or specialty shaped replacement. Frame repair. Rotten sills, damaged jambs, or a twisted opening can add labor and materials before the new unit even goes in. Material selection. The jump from basic vinyl to wood or clad-wood can be significant, especially when the project involves custom finishing. Labor and access. Upper floors, tight alley access, masonry openings, and careful interior trim work all take more time. Permits and review. Depending on the scope, you may need a permit, and historic properties can also trigger BAR review or a Certificate of Appropriateness.
For many homeowners, the real cost driver is not the unit on the truck, it is what the installer finds once the old window comes out.
That is why two neighboring houses can end up with very different pricing, even if both are replacing the same number of windows.
Why Alexandria Historic Homes Often Cost More To Window Replace
In Alexandria, historic oversight can change both the material choices and the timeline, especially where BAR approval, the Board of Architectural Review window guidelines Alexandria, or other preservation rules apply.
On some projects, approval is not optional. It is part of the budget because it affects what products can be used and how long the job takes to start.
The question is not just what is cheapest, it is what the district will accept.
The real issue is not the label on the product, it is whether the replacement meets the approved appearance for that property.
For many older houses, wood vs clad-wood windows Old Town Alexandria is a more realistic comparison than vinyl versus everything else.
Details such as true divided lite windows Alexandria VA, muntin pattern requirements Alexandria historic windows, and restoration glass vs new construction glass windows can all change the final price.
The same is true for pre-1932 home window replacement Alexandria, where sash replacement kits historic Alexandria homes may sometimes make more sense than full replacement.
